Latest Patents

Yoshioka's latest patents include a truss-type girder for supporting a movable body and a centrifugal counterflow type contactor. The truss-type girder features a truss structure with an isosceles triangle cross-section, designed to support a movable body effectively. This girder incorporates three main tubes and multiple branch tubes, ensuring stability and strength. The centrifugal counterflow type contactor is designed to improve the extraction efficiency of liquids by utilizing a rotating drum with strategically placed baffle plates. This innovative design prevents the accumulation of solids in the counterflow region, enhancing overall performance.
